In Swift, you can use array-like indexing or the prefix
method to get the first character of a string.
In this example,
str
with a value of "Hello World"
.startIndex
on the string str
or the prefix
method with argument 1
to get the first character.let str = "Hello World"
let firstChar = str[str.startIndex]
print("First character: \(firstChar)")
First character: H
